MP3 Music Players


The MP3 music player, commonly referred to as the MP3 player, is a device that is able to playback MP3 encoded audio files. There have been many other types of audio playback formats, including CDs, cassettes, and vinyl records, but the MP3 player offers perhaps the most convenient and practical way of listening to music. Depending on the size of the storage disk on the device, an MP3 player can hold up to thousands of songs in a size that is often even smaller and lighter than a cassette tape. Types of MP3 player

There are numerous types of MP3 player in the market, but these can be categorized into four common types. First are the hard drive players, which actually makes use of a spinning hard drive to store, playback, and manipulate files. The second type of player, the flash memory player, makes use of small flash disks that don't have moving parts. Flash memory players are often more durable and energy-efficient in comparison to hard drive players, but their hard drives normally have larger storage space. Third are MP3 disk players, which include car steroes, home stereoes, and other optical disk drives capable of playing back MP3 files. Finally, there are hybrid players, such as DVD players, mobile phones, satellite radios, and other devices, that have MP3 playback capabilities as well as other major functions.

The convenience of using MP3 players

- Most players are highly portable.
- MP3 files are widely available through the Internet.
- You can easily make copies of your own audio CDs to fill your player.
- Some players and hybrid devices have extra features and functions.
- They fit thousands of songs with barely the size of your palm.
